Thoroughly researched and extensively referenced, this highly credible work uses evidence from biblical, anthropological, historical, and ancient literature sources dating as far back as 3,000 years ago to support the facts that: People of color have a positive history. People of color were the first to give structure and order in society. Scripture cites Black role models. Current issues such as idolatry and slavery have their roots in the practices of ancestors. Color was not used as a segregating tool until 300 years ago. Racial equality is a truth Black people have different issues. There is nothing wrong with being black. I have said,...all of you are children of the most High (Psalm 82:6). Pastor of the largest church in Western Europe, Matthew Ashimolowo looks at the glorious past of the Black race and examines uncompromisingly the conformations that have molded Black people. His fascinating insight celebrates the rich heritage and confronts today s challenges.

Pastor Matthew Ashimolowo is the Senior Pastor of Kingsway International Christian Centre, a church which has grown to become the largest in Western Europe with around 12,000 people in weekly attendance. Pastor, teacher, evangelist and businessman, he has inspired countless souls with his passionate preaching of the living Word. His dynamic on-air ministry in viewed by a potential audience of several hundred million people in Europe, Africa, Asia, the USA and the Caribbean. His influence on church growth and evangelism has been noted by local and international news media. Winner of the Nigeria Booksellers Award for best author with Tongues of Fire , Pastor Matthew has written over 60 compelling books. He sits on the board of Reference for many leading organisations.
